Web2 mrt. 2024 · Visual field means the area a human or animal can see when they have their eyes focused on one point. So, peripheral vision essentially—what can be seen to the side, straight ahead, below, and above where one is looking. Cats have an advantage here because their visual field is 200-degrees, which is wider than a human’s. In principle there exist infinitely many distinct spectral colors, and so the set of all physical … Meer weergeven WebHow color vision is tested: This test measures your ability to see a pattern based on its color. By testing with different colors we are able to understand which colors you may have difficulty seeing. When a person has color blindness, they are able to see some colors better than others.
